This is really funny. I had second gear crunch too. Swepco did NOT fix it, neither did Mobil One. Redline Shockproof saved the day. Funny how different each of our experiences are with the same cars!
Probably more about climate. It is hot here, so that think gooey Shockproof does well. It most certainly would not do well in a cold climate.

Used Mobil 1 75W90 in my '95; worked great. Car has 90K miles on it and no tranny problems.
Now, on my '98 Audi A4 it was a different matter. When I changed tranny oil, same Mobil 1 in there made the tranny feel like it needed replacement; noisy and ground gears real bad. Replacement with Redline 75W90 brought the transmission to feeling great (100K miles on this car). Why the difference I don't know.
